What Does It Mean to Power Both AC and DC Loads?

Before we get into the details, let’s clarify what AC and DC loads entail. AC, or alternating current, powers the majority of household appliances, from your refrigerator to your washing machine. On the flip side, DC, or direct current, gives life to smaller devices like LED lights and mobile phone chargers. So, when we say that standalone PV systems can support both types of loads, what we’re really talking about is a system that flexibly meets diverse energy needs.

The Magic of Inverter Technology

You might be wondering, how does this all work? That’s where inverter technology comes in. Standalone PV systems incorporate an inverter to convert DC electricity generated by solar panels into AC power. Think of the inverter as a translator, bridging the gap between solar energy and your energy-hungry appliances. With this flexibility, users can power a wide array of equipment without needing a complicated setup.
